This method relies to the principle that diverse molecules absorb UV light at diverse wavelengths and intensities.
Air may be considered a filter since wavelengths of light shorter than about 200 nm are absorbed by molecular oxygen from the air. A Particular and more expensive set up is necessary for measurements with wavelengths shorter than 200 nm, ordinarily involving an optical technique stuffed with pure argon gas. UV/visible spectroscopy requires measuring the absorption of ultraviolet or visible light-weight by molecules. It utilizes light inside the wavelength variety of two hundred-800 nm. The important thing elements of a UV-visible spectrophotometer are a light resource, wavelength selector like a monochromator, sample holder, detector, and related electronics.
Specific gentle resources like tungsten-halogen lamps, hydrogen and xenon discharge lamps are lined. Requirements for an excellent light-weight source and functioning principles of filters, prisms and diffraction gratings as monochromators are summarized.
